A workshop on the FASTDOC project will take place at Patras University, Greece, on 4-6 March 1996. FASTDOC is a European project, part-financed by the Commission within the framework of DG XIII's LIBRARIES programme.

FASTDOC aims at the development and testing of a prototype fast electronic document order and delivery system, based on an image archive of chemical literature used in the Frankfurt Beilstein Institute in Germany.

The project has now reached the alpha-testing phase with considerable success. All technical implications are solved and the partners are testing the consistency of the ordering system and the communications software.

The coordinator of the project is the Beilstein Institute. The other partners are the Universitat Autonoma de Barcelona, the Fachinformationszentrum Karlsruhe and the University of Patras.
